Understanding the Toyota Camry Ignition System

Before we dive into the process of unlocking the ignition, it’s essential to understand how the Toyota Camry ignition system works. The ignition system is designed to provide a safe and secure way to start the engine. The system consists of several components, including the ignition switch, the steering column, and the immobilizer system. The immobilizer system is a security feature that prevents the engine from starting unless the correct key is inserted into the ignition switch.

Unlocking the Ignition with a Key

If your Toyota Camry has a traditional ignition system, you’ll need to use a key to unlock the ignition. To do this, follow these steps:

Insert the key into the ignition switch and turn it clockwise to the “on” position. You should hear a click as the ignition switch engages. Once the ignition switch is engaged, you can start the engine by turning the key clockwise to the “start” position.

Troubleshooting Ignition Issues

If you’re having trouble unlocking the ignition on your Toyota Camry, there are several things you can try to troubleshoot the issue. First, make sure that the key is properly inserted into the ignition switch and that it’s turned to the correct position. If the key is not turning, you may need to use a lubricant to loosen the ignition switch. You can also try jiggling the key back and forth to see if it will turn.

What are the steps to unlock the ignition on a Toyota Camry?

To unlock the ignition on a Toyota Camry, start by inserting the correct key into the ignition switch. Gently turn the key to the “on” position, but do not start the engine. If the ignition is locked, the key may not turn easily, so be careful not to force it. Next, check the steering column for any obstructions or blockages that may be preventing the key from turning. If the problem persists, try jiggling the steering wheel back and forth while turning the key to dislodge any blockages.

If the ignition is still locked, it may be necessary to use a specialized tool to unlock it. A professional mechanic or a Toyota dealership can use these tools to release the lock and allow the key to turn. In some cases, it may be necessary to replace the ignition switch or cylinder if it is damaged or worn out. It is essential to use the correct tools and techniques to avoid damaging the vehicle’s electrical system or other components. What are the costs associated with unlocking the ignition on a Toyota Camry?

The costs associated with unlocking the ignition on a Toyota Camry can vary depending on the nature of the problem and the solution required. If the issue is simple, such as a worn-out key or a faulty ignition switch, the cost may be relatively low, ranging from $50 to $200. However, if the problem is more complex, such as a faulty ignition cylinder or a damaged electrical system, the cost can be significantly higher, ranging from $500 to $1,000 or more.

In addition to the cost of repairs, owners may also need to consider the cost of any additional services, such as diagnostic testing or maintenance. If the vehicle is still under warranty, the cost of repairs may be covered, but owners should check their warranty terms and conditions to confirm. It is essential to get a detailed estimate from a professional mechanic or dealership before proceeding with any repairs to ensure that the costs are transparent and reasonable.
